About

A lightweight bionic two-finger robotic sensing and manipulation device designed to capture high-precision motion, tactile, and spatial data with human-like efficiency and integrated vision and IMU systems.

Specs

A 300 g dual-finger robotic manipulator with millimeter-level trajectory reconstruction powered by a BEV-odometry neural network. It features 3D tactile sensing (0.05 N sensitivity), 6-axis IMU (200 Hz), fisheye camera (>150° FOV), and multimodal data capture (UHD images, spatial trajectories, tactile data, audio). The system operates at 100 Hz, supports up to 2 kg gripping force, and includes Wi-Fi/Bluetooth connectivity, 64 GB storage, and 3.5-hour battery life.
